Ver Mensaje Individual
  #7 (permalink)  
Antiguo 28/10/2011, 11:44
Avatar de HackmanC
HackmanC
 
Fecha de Ingreso: enero-2008
Ubicación: Guatemala
Mensajes: 1.817
Antigüedad: 16 años, 9 meses
Puntos: 260
Sonrisa Respuesta: Eterno dilema: ¿AWT o Swing?

Hola,

Cita:
Iniciado por 1antares1 Ver Mensaje
... Ya te diste cuenta la cantidad de código que se lleva colocar un fondo en un Frame. ...
Si, tienes toda la razón, pero para mí no fue un dolor de cabeza, y lo escribí en menos de 30 segundos, contrario a lo que mencionaste. Aunque la cantidad de líneas necesarias se resume en tres sin contar el override del paint, y seis si contamos ese método, que no es obligatorio en una aplicación normal.

Pero acá viene lo importante, eso me da versatilidad para crear aplicaciones, yo puedo inclusive pintar con métodos de dibujo, hacer una animación en el fondo de la ventana, mostrar un vídeo cuadro a cuadro o lo que mi imaginación me lo permita. Contrario a tener una propiedad que diga 'backgroundImage' y que solamente me permita poner una imagen.

Cita:
Iniciado por 1antares1 Ver Mensaje
... Cuando Java se puedan hacer aplicaciones de escritorio, usando xHTML, CSS, así como se hace JavaScript para WebApps, sería perfecto. Estaría dispuesto a seguir programando en Java. ...
Tienes toda la razón en ese punto también, para hacer una página web no es necesario tener tanto conocimiento, es muy simple el proceso y el flujo de trabajo es bastante natural. Con saber lo básico de HTML y CSS ya tienes para hacer una página simple. El Javascript yo lo considero con un valor agregado puesto que no es indispensable y es un error depender de este para diseñar en web.

El punto es que la pregunta dice ¿AWT o Swing?. Como no es posible escribir HTML dentro de un Layout de Swing o algo similar, entonces creo que es irrelevante para la pregunta inicial. Y por eso decía que no tiene nada que ver, de otra forma sería escritorio o web.

Saludos,